Given the multifactorial nature of these diseases, high-throughput, high-sensitivity technologies are essential for comprehensive immune profiling and biomarker quantification. The Ella Immunoassay System (Bio-Techne) offers an unparalleled solution for multiplexed, protein-based analysis of serum and plasma samples, with minimal sample volume requirements and superior analytical precision. Specifically, the Ella enables reproducible quantification of biomarkers such as neurofilament light chain (NfL) and glial fibrillary acidic protein (GFAP), which are critical indicators of axonal damage and astrocyte activation, respectively. Collaborating researchers have consistently cited Ella’s rapid turnaround, high sensitivity, and platform stability as key factors supporting its use in translational neuroimmunology studies.
